Bugweri road crash claims one
By Abubaker Kirunda At least one person is confirmed to have died while another has been critically injured following a road crash that occurred on Monday morning in Bugweri District. The crash happened in Idudi Town Council along the Bugweri-Bugiri road. Busoga East police spokesperson Michael Kafayo says the road crash involved an Isuzu Elf Truck registration No UAF 788M and a Motorcycle registration No UFT 468Y. Michael Kafayo explains that according to preliminary investigations, the truck driver made an abrupt turn off from the road coming from Bugiri, knocking two people who were travelling on a motorcycle. NRM commends Kuteesa for stepping down for Museveni’s brother
By Damali Mukhaye The National Resistance Movement (NRM) Electoral Commission has commended Shartis Kuteesa for stepping down in favor of Sodo Kaguta, President Museveni’s younger brother, in the Sembabule constituency parliamentary race. Shartis, daughter of former Foreign Affairs Minister Sam Kuteesa and Sodo were both nominated last week to compete for the party parliamentary flag in Sembabule. However, a few days after their nomination, Kuteesa withdrew from the race after meeting with president Museveni who is also the party’s national chairperson. The NRM Electoral Commission Chairperson Dr.Tanga Odoi said her decision has eased the Commission’s work since there will be no need to organize primaries in the area. Anti-Corruption CSOs task government on witness protection law
By Mike Sebalu Anti- Corruption Civil Society Organizations in Uganda have asked the government to prioritize the establishment of the witness protection law in the new 5 year National Anti-Corruption Strategy. The government is currently assessing the current strategy which ended with the 2023/2024 financial year. The plan provides a framework for implementing the ZTCP, which aims at establishing anti-corruption institutions, preventing corruption, encouraging public participation, fostering integrity and promoting individual commitment. It also guides stakeholders in responding to corruption according to the Zero Tolerance to Corruption Policy.
